Description (CMS Description)
Necklace composed of four whale teeth strung on a cord of two-ply twisted coir and interspaced with flat beads carved from coconut wood and four flat and white shell beads. The end of the cord is tied with a knot at one end and stopped with red wax at the other end. The tip of one of the teeth has been flattened. On three of the teeth, attachment holes have been severely damaged and new ones drilled. '25.298' inscribed in black ink on two of the teeth.
